New Year's Knitting



As requested by Fran, here is the Lizard Ridge square made using the pink ball of Noro that you so kindly sent me. Isn't it great?! These colours really jump out at you! I have decided to get Lizard finished as a priority now. Only another 8 'squares' left to go! I need more Noro (oh what a shame I'll have to buy more yarn) but I have very ingeniously made a ball up using all the scraps and leftovers. So that's one less to buy!

Looks like my New Year's Resolution of not buying more yarn has already gone out of the window! Like the diet one as well. Quick, not had chocolate for 10 mins. Need some quickly before I fade away...

Oh and the other piece of knitting on the picture is the Moebius Shawl using the Qiviut. I'm trying very hard to follow the pattern, but me and lace don't go very well together. Not sure if I've got the right number of stitches (think I have, but 359 stitches all joined up together on a twisted circular needle are a bit hard to count)My pattern doesn't look much the one photographed either, but hopefully if I just keep going it will be similar-ish before too long.

I keep meaning to say about the blankets too. I think I now have enough squares to make 2 more blankets (well at least I will have once the spare American ones come over here), so please don't send any more - unless of course you have already knitted some, then by all means send them along. It's been great fun making these blankets and I'm so pleased that you've all joined in too. We have raised over £1,200 so far (please tell me you agree with that amount Emma) and Oliver now has his new wheel chair. Big thank-yous all round!
